Manifestations of Kidney Qi deficiency

Kidney qi deficiency is manifested by tinnitus, dizziness and forgetfulness, lumbago and loss of libido, etc. The treatment should be to replenish kidney qi. Kidney qi deficiency is a disease caused by overwork, congenital insufficiency, prolonged illness and kidney, manifesting as pale and colorless face, tinnitus, dizziness, forgetfulness, dizziness, lumbar pain and soreness, spermatorrhea and premature ejaculation, irregular menstruation in women, fatigue (lack of mental energy) and limb softness, loss of hearing, nocturnal polydipsia, and pediatric dyspareunia, etc. The treatment should be based on tonifying the kidney qi. The treatment of kidney qi deficiency should be based on tonifying kidney qi, which can be treated with traditional Chinese medicines such as ripened rhubarb, wolfberry, roasted licorice, yam, cornelian cherry, cinnamon, and dulcimer under the doctor’s guidance.
